CRYPTOCURRENCY INVESTING FOR BEGINNERS

WHAT IS CRYPTOCURRENCY?

Cryptocurrency

is a digital or virtual currency that uses cryptography for security and is decentralized, meaning it’s not controlled by any government or financial institution. The most well-known cryptocurrency is Bitcoin, but there are many others, such as Ethereum, Litecoin, and Monero.

IS CRYPTOCURRENCY INVESTING RISKY?

Like any investment, cryptocurrency investing carries risks. The value of cryptocurrencies can fluctuate rapidly and unpredictably, and there is a risk of losing money if you invest in a cryptocurrency that doesn’t perform well. Additionally, the cryptocurrency market is not regulated in the same way as traditional markets, which can make it more vulnerable to scams and other forms of fraud.

HOW DO I GET STARTED WITH CRYPTOCURRENCY INVESTING?

To get started with cryptocurrency investing, you’ll need to:

  • Learn about cryptocurrencies**: Research different types of cryptocurrencies and their potential uses.
  • Set up a digital wallet**: A digital wallet is a software program that allows you to store, send, and receive cryptocurrencies.
  • Choose a cryptocurrency exchange**: A cryptocurrency exchange is a platform that allows you to buy and sell cryptocurrencies.
  • Start small**: Don’t invest more than you can afford to lose.
  • Stay informed**: Stay up-to-date with market news and trends.

WHAT ARE THE BENEFITS OF CRYPTOCURRENCY INVESTING?

Cryptocurrency investing offers several benefits, including:

  • Decentralization**: Cryptocurrencies are decentralized, meaning they’re not controlled by any government or financial institution.
  • Security**: Cryptocurrencies use advanced cryptography to secure transactions and control the creation of new units.
  • Portability**: Cryptocurrencies can be easily transferred and stored electronically.
  • Limited supply**: Most cryptocurrencies have a limited supply, which can help to prevent inflation.

WHAT ARE THE RISKS OF CRYPTOCURRENCY INVESTING?

Cryptocurrency investing carries several risks, including:

  • Volatility**: The value of cryptocurrencies can fluctuate rapidly and unpredictably.
  • Lack of regulation**: The cryptocurrency market is not regulated in the same way as traditional markets.
  • Security risks**: Cryptocurrencies can be vulnerable to hacking and other forms of cybercrime.
  • Scams and fraud**: The cryptocurrency market is vulnerable to scams and other forms of fraud.

CONCLUSION

Cryptocurrency investing can be a high-risk, high-reward investment opportunity. Before investing in cryptocurrencies, it’s essential to do your research, set clear goals, and understand the risks involved. Remember to start small, stay informed, and never invest more than you can afford to lose.
